Output 6eb8d5b7a6321f7656236a4d3a68dd0faceb13d1052f6ac30ad9a67338bd7807:0

value
5735129165
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d50e516f5084492e8e8c176402075f9ad019b083dd9a45b9d870417217f9ef61
address
tb1p6589zm6ss3yjar5vzajqyp6lntgpnvyrmkdytwwcwpqhy9leaass97k3cv
transaction
6eb8d5b7a6321f7656236a4d3a68dd0faceb13d1052f6ac30ad9a67338bd7807
confirmations
71951
spent
true